Use of mathematical models for logistical planning.

Jack D. Little

Expert InsightsPublished 1958

A study that defines machine models and explains their uses in logistic planning and experimentation. As examples, a description is given of "Laboratory Project 1" (a man-machine model) and of the Missile Support Model (a machine model used in "Laboratory Project 2"). The paper discusses the purpose of these models, the general procedure used in creating the models, the trouble areas found in this creative period, the results obtained from the running of the models, the trouble areas found in the running of the models, and other possible uses of models.

This publication is part of the RAND paper series. The paper series was a product of RAND from 1948 to 2003 that captured speeches, memorials, and derivative research, usually prepared on authors' own time and meant to be the scholarly or scientific contribution of individual authors to their professional fields. Papers were less formal than reports and did not require rigorous peer review.
